DU Bookstore to Host Dual Book Signings by Gussins
Nov. 3, 2010
Writers Dr. Robert Gussin and his wife, Dr. Patricia Gussin, will be at the Duquesne University Barnes & Noble Bookstore for book signings this week.
The Gussins will be at the bookstore on Friday, Nov. 5, from 11: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m.
Robert, a distinguished Duquesne alumnus and a member of the University’s Board of Directors, has written What’s Next…For You? The Gussin Guide to Big Decisions, Big Changes, and Big Fun, a strategic marketing guide.
Patricia will be signing copies of her novel And Then There Was One. Nominated for the Thriller Award for Best First Novel, it tells the high-tension story about a parent’s worst nightmare—a kidnapping—becoming reality.
The Gussins endowed the Robert and Patricia Gussin Spiritan Division of Academic Programs and are the benefactors of an endowed scholarship for minority students.
Duquesne University
Founded in 1878, Duquesne is consistently ranked among the nation's top Catholic research universities for its award-winning faculty and tradition of academic excellence. The University is nationally ranked by U.S. News and World Report and the Princeton Review for its rich academic programs in 10 schools of study for 10,000-plus graduate and undergraduate students, and by the Washington Monthly for service and contributing to students’ social mobility. Duquesne is a member of the U.S. President’s Higher Education Community Service Honor Roll with Distinction for its contributions to Pittsburgh and communities around the globe. The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ency and the Princeton Review’s Guide to Green Colleges acknowledge Duquesne’s commitment to sustainability.
